Language/Python

[Python] 람다 함수

pinomaker 2022. 6. 12. 15:21

람다 함수란?

작고, 이름이 없는 함수를 말한다. 

 

람다  함수 선언 및 사용

람다 함수는 임시적으로 사용하는 것이기에, 정의가 되지 않지만 변수에  저장하여 사용할 수도 있고, 선언하자마자 호출이 가능하다.

# lambda 인자 : 실행식
lamda a, b : a + b
 
# 즉시 호출
print((lambda a, b : a + b)(3,  5)) # 8

# 변수에 람다 함수 저장
add = lamda a, b : a + b
print(add(3, 6)) # 9